摘要

A carbon quantum dot (CQD)-protoporphyrin (Ⅸ) sensitisier conjugate was designed to exploit the large two-photon absorption cross section of CQDs and enable the indirect excitation of the sensitiser with 800 nm irradiation via FRET.
